Juli Caujapé‐Castells is a scholar working on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ics, Genetics and Plant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Juli Caujapé‐Castells has authored 109 papers receiving a total of 2.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 61 papers in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ics, 61 papers in Genetics and 55 papers in Plant Science. Recurrent topics in Juli Caujapé‐Castells's work include Genetic diversity and population structure (61 papers), Plant Diversity and Evolution (35 papers) and Mediterranean and Iberian flora and fauna (25 papers). Juli Caujapé‐Castells is often cited by papers focused on Genetic diversity and population structure (61 papers), Plant Diversity and Evolution (35 papers) and Mediterranean and Iberian flora and fauna (25 papers). Juli Caujapé‐Castells collaborates with scholars based in Spain, United States and Portugal. Juli Caujapé‐Castells's co-authors include Ruth Jaén‐Molina, Joan Pedrola‐Monfort, Carlos García‐Verdugo, Arnoldo Santos‐Guerra, Pedro A. Sosa, Daniel J. Crawford, Mónica Moura, Robert K. Jansen, José María Fernández‐Palacios and Alan Tye and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Molecular Ecology and Biological reviews/Biological reviews of the Cambridge Philosophical Society.
